How This Curriculum Is Used

From Eden to Eternity™ is a single, unified year of biblical doctrine.

It is not divided by grade level.

All students study the same Scripture passages, doctrines, and redemptive themes each week, following an ordered progression from Genesis to Revelation. Instruction is shared, while student work is differentiated by maturity.

This structure allows families to teach one coherent theological framework across multiple ages without separating children into grade level workbooks.The curriculum functions as a complete academic year of biblical doctrine instruction, excluding only mathematics.


What’s Included

The hardcover doctrinal volume (about 520 pages) serves as the centerpiece. It contains six units, organized day-by-day with clear markings for each week. Each week begins with prayer, an introduction to the theme, and a Solus Christus section - tying the week’s study together by showing Christ as the redemptive thread through all of Scripture.

There are four structured teaching days each week, with a fifth left open for flexibility—often used for the science experiment, martyr study, homemaking, or review. Each day’s Exegesis section includes Scripture readings and doctrinal explanation that connect to the Christ Connection and activity sections in the Workbooks. All materials are self-contained, so parents won’t need outside sources. Each day closes with a Summa Theologiae—a brief summary highlighting key truths for review and discussion.

  • 6 Teacher Workbooks (spiral-bound)
    Full daily guidance for every lesson — no prep, no searching, no guessing. Each guide provides complete instructional guidance, theological explanations, and key definitions so parents can lead confidently and faithfully. 

  • 6 Student Workbooks (spiral-bound)
    Designed for multigenerational teaching.

Each unit aligns with the main textbook, allowing every child to engage at age-appropriate depth:

    • Kindergarten: narration, oral Bible reading, and illustration.

    • Elementary/Middle School: Scripture copying, guided responses, and memory work.

    • Middle/High School : apologetics, theology prompts, and written summaries.

The curriculum does not dilute doctrine for younger students or simplify it for older ones.
Depth increases with age; theology remains consistent.
